The Painkillers

If you feel that the pain has just started in your shoulder and it is mild, then opt for simple pain killers or non-steroidal anti-inflammatory tablets or creams that will prevent the progression of pain.

Improvement In your Posture!

Feeling shoulder pain? Check for your posture first. There are times when you carry yourself with a poor posture thinking that it is somewhat a comfortable position. But you must be aware that your positions, like slouching or leaning forward at the desk or while standing or sitting can lead you to stiffness in your joints and then to chronic pain. Try to change your position frequently and also work on your posture in order to prevent chronic shoulder pain.

Lessen the Stress on your Shoulders

While performing the daily activities, or involved in our office tasks, we, by mistake lift heavy objects and that too in a wrong posture. This can also contribute towards chronic shoulder pain. The tasks like vacuuming in which you have to bend the upper part of your body, the usage of phones being held improperly or for a greater period of time can also lead to most of the strain in the body.
